More about the Greenmound Juniper...
Green Mound Juniper is a very attractive low-growing juniper that distinctively mounds at the center of the patch of foliage. The handsome, light mint-green foliage grows 3 to 4 inches in height, with the center mound reaching up to 12 inches in height. The spread is about 5 to 6 feet.
Green Mound Juniper is excellent for use on slopes and embankments, but equally useful in small groups, as a border, or as an underplanting for small trees such as the Japanese maple. It can also be staked to create an exquisite, cascading topiary.
